Description

Nestled within a peaceful cul-de-sac in the highly sought-after area of Crossgates, this attractive three-bedroom detached home offers a wonderful opportunity for families and buyers alike.

Boasting a quiet residential setting, the property benefits from private, mature gardens and is offered to the market with the added advantage of no onward chain.

The ground floor features a spacious and welcoming living room, enhanced by a charming bay window that fills the space with natural light. To the rear, a well-proportioned kitchen/diner provides an ideal setting for both everyday living and entertaining, with the addition of a pantry and direct access into a bright conservatory overlooking the garden - perfect for enjoying the outdoors all year round. A convenient downstairs WC and internal access to the garage complete the ground floor accommodation.

Upstairs, the property offers three well-sized bedrooms, including a generous principal bedroom, along with a family bathroom. The layout is ideal for growing families or those seeking flexible living space. There is also access to the boarded loft space via a pull-down ladder.

Externally, the home enjoys a driveway providing off-street parking for two vehicles and access to the attached garage. To the rear, the private garden is mainly laid to lawn and bordered by mature shrubs and hedging, creating a peaceful and secluded outdoor space. There is also a flagged patio area which provides an ideal space for al fresco dining.

Ideally positioned in a quiet cul-de-sac within the ever-popular suburb of Crossgates, the property enjoys a superb balance of tranquillity and convenience. Crossgates is highly regarded for its excellent local amenities, including a wide range of shops, cafés, and supermarkets, as well as the Crossgates Shopping Centre. The area is particularly well served by reputable schools, making it a strong choice for families.

For commuters, Crossgates railway station provides regular and direct links to Leeds city centre, while nearby road networks, including the A64 and A1(M), offer easy access to surrounding areas. Additionally, the nearby Temple Newsam estate provides beautiful green space, perfect for outdoor walks and leisure activities, further enhancing the appeal of this well-connected yet peaceful location.
